Output d70d21aab872abc9250b3ec25dd4fec1d5bfb2cf14945b0efaea6d809c655331:76

value
5689
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3a62f20e695905ae9990e28cb37a805f4bccb9c8ff8f2eb001a66d73ab7bf2f
address
bc1pcwnz7g8xjkg946vepc5vkdagqh6tejuu3lu096cqrfndww4hhuhs3c3x37
transaction
d70d21aab872abc9250b3ec25dd4fec1d5bfb2cf14945b0efaea6d809c655331
spent
true